HarmonyOS鸿蒙Next中调用接口上传apk一直提示报错不知道为什么?该如何解决

HarmonyOS鸿蒙Next中调用接口上传apk一直提示报错不知道为什么?该如何解决 通过调用https://developer.huawei.com/consumer/cn/doc/development/AppGallery-connect-References/agcapi-app-submit-0000001158245061接口提交更新应用版本信息,但一致提示提交失败,错误返回参数是:[AppGalleryConnectPublishService]The package is being compiled, please try again in 3-5 minutes。原因是什么?能否解释下?这个问题该怎么解决?


更多关于HarmonyOS鸿蒙Next中调用接口上传apk一直提示报错不知道为什么?该如何解决的实战教程也可以访问 https://www.itying.com/category-93-b0.html

4 回复

您好,你需要过几分钟再看,这个是正常提示,编译完后才能提交审核

更多关于HarmonyOS鸿蒙Next中调用接口上传apk一直提示报错不知道为什么?该如何解决的实战系列教程也可以访问 https://www.itying.com/category-93-b0.html


开发者您好,相关问题已经反馈给工作人员,稍后会再回复您,感谢您对华为开发者论坛的支持。

在HarmonyOS鸿蒙Next中调用接口上传APK时出现报错,可能涉及以下几个原因:

  • 接口权限问题:确保应用已正确配置相关权限,如ohos.permission.INTERNET,并在config.json中声明。

  • 网络配置问题:检查网络连接是否正常,确保设备可以访问目标服务器。如果使用HTTPS,确保证书配置正确。

  • 接口参数问题:确认上传接口的请求参数(如URL、请求头、请求体)是否符合要求,特别是文件格式和大小限制。

  • 文件路径问题:确保APK文件路径正确,且文件存在。如果使用相对路径,建议使用绝对路径或context.getFilesDir()获取文件路径。

  • 服务器问题:检查服务器端是否正常接收和处理请求,查看服务器日志以获取更多信息。

  • 鸿蒙API版本兼容性:确保使用的鸿蒙API版本与设备系统版本兼容,避免因API不兼容导致报错。

  • 日志分析:通过HiLogconsole查看详细错误日志,定位具体问题。

  • 代码实现问题:检查上传代码逻辑,确保正确调用鸿蒙提供的网络请求API,如@ohos.net.http模块。

如果以上检查无误,仍无法解决问题,建议参考鸿蒙官方文档或社区论坛,查找类似问题的解决方案。

在HarmonyOS鸿蒙Next中调用接口上传APK时遇到报错,可能原因包括:

  1. 接口参数不正确,如文件路径、格式或大小不符合要求;

  2. 网络连接不稳定或服务器问题;

  3. 权限不足,如未获取必要的文件读写权限。

解决方法:

  1. 检查并确保所有参数正确无误;

  2. 确认网络连接正常,尝试重新上传;

  3. config.json中配置所需权限,并确保应用已获取相应权限。

回到顶部